| EARS WERE UP AND NOW AT 5 MONTHS THEY ARE DOWN! Input PLEASE! Sadie's ears are flopping over, and she has had them up for at least 2 months. She got spayed, and she is probably teething... I know these things can be part of the problem. but will her ears go back up again? I would like them to but she does look cute this way if they don't.

I ♥ Joey & Ralphie! Donating Member | What a little doll, I love the coloring. Perfect face!! I've heard many say their ears went down around this age due to spaying and teething. Some people have found it helpful to keep the hair clipped short on the top third of the ear, and of course, I'm sure you've heard about taping. If you don't want her, I'll sure take her!
